Fresh Shiitake Mushrooms. Start by taking the shiitake mushrooms out of their packaging. Grab a storage bag and place a paper towel in it. Add the shiitake mushrooms and place the bag in the refrigerator, leaving it opened, preferably in the vegetable crisper. This will keep the mushrooms fresh for about 1 week.

Cook the mushrooms. Add the butter and olive oil to a large skillet over medium heat. Once hot, add in the mushrooms and let them sit at medium heat. Avoid stirring or moving them around for about 3 minutes. This creates lovely caramelization around the edges of the mushrooms. Stir and cook for 2 more minutes.

You can find shiitake mushrooms in the following forms: Fresh: If fresh shiitake mushrooms stay dry, they can last a week in the refrigerator.; Dried: Dried whole or sliced shiitake mushrooms have a much longer shelf life.Unless you add them to soups or stews, you'll want to rehydrate them first. Shiitake mushrooms, or shiitake (椎茸), are edible fungi native to East Asia. In Japanese, shii (椎) is "hardwood tree," and take (茸) is "mushroom.". It's consumed fresh, dried.

Shiitake mushrooms have a distinct appearance that makes them easy to tell from other species. The cap measures 5-15 cm (2-6 in) and is usually convex (although it may appear flat in some specimens). Its color usually ranges from light to dark brown, with its center showing a darker tone.
